IDEA打印调试工具-LoggerFactory.getLogger

在IDEA编辑器中需要调试的类比如 **ServiceImpl类,可以在类下面第一行放一个
private static final Logger logger = LoggerFactory.getLogger(**ServiceImpl.class);
,这样就不用使用最基础的 "System.out.println();"来打印输出,而可以直接用

logger.info("我想打印的第一个结果:{},第二个结果", out1, out2)
占位符输出,还是比较方便的。
更加详细的内容可以参考 java日志LoggerFactory.getLogger最全讲解使用方法


2022-10-31 补充
这里要加一下Maven依赖,以示区分,比较有很多包都有slf4j

        <dependency>
            <groupId>org.apache.logging.log4j</groupId>
            <artifactId>log4j-api</artifactId>
            <version>2.17.1</version>
        </dependency>
        <dependency>
            <groupId>org.apache.logging.log4j</groupId>
            <artifactId>log4j-core</artifactId>
            <version>2.17.1</version>
        </dependency>

2022-12-09
@Slf4j注解替代上述代码的书写(少些一行代码)
如何使用,待整理ing

posted @ 2022-08-01 09:58  又一个蛇佬腔  阅读(239)  评论(0编辑  收藏  举报